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Claim Investigator
What are the key skills required to be a successful Claim Investigator?
The key skills required to be a successful Claim Investigator include strong analytical and problem-solving abilities, excellent communication and interpersonal skills, and a thorough understanding of insurance policies and procedures.
What are the career prospects for Claim Investigators?
The career prospects for Claim Investigators are generally good, with many opportunities for advancement to senior-level positions. With experience, Claim Investigators can move into management roles, such as Claims Manager or Claims Director.
What is the average salary for Claim Investigators?
The average salary for Claim Investigators varies depending on experience, location, and employer.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ual salary for Claim Investigators was $63,960 in May 2021.
What are the educational requirements to become a Claim Investigator?
Most Claim Investigators have a bachelor’s degree in a related field, such as criminal justice, insurance, or business. Some employers may also require Claim Investigators to have a license or certification.
What are the challenges of being a Claim Investigator?
The challenges of being a Claim Investigator include dealing with difficult claimants, investigating complex claims, and working long hours. Claim Investigators must also be able to handle stress and pressure.
